Both glaciers and volcanoes are significant geological features on Earth. They are both formed through natural processes, with glaciers originating from accumulating snow and ice, and volcanoes developing from magma rising to the surface. Both glaciers and volcanoes have the potential to dramatically reshape landscapes through their movement or eruptions. They can influence local ecosystems and have environmental impacts on surrounding areas.

There are three main shapes of volcanoes: shield volcanoes, cinder cone volcanoes, and stratovolcanoes. Each type has distinct characteristics based on its eruption style, lava composition, and shape.

Iceland is known for having glaciers, but it is an island made from the continual eruptions of volcanos. About every 5 years, an eruption occurs adding to the land mass, creating geysers, and hot springs, and providing a great contrast with the glaciers nearby.
